One of the best ways to get started with the Hello Kitty Bass is to practice basic techniques and scales. This will help you build a strong foundation and allow you to explore more advanced playing styles as you become more comfortable with the instrument. Some essential techniques to focus on include:
- Fingerpicking: This technique involves using your fingers to pluck the strings, allowing for a more nuanced and expressive sound.
- Slapping and Popping: Popular in funk and hip-hop, this technique involves striking the strings with your thumb and plucking them with your fingers to create a percussive sound.
- Hammer-ons and Pull-offs: These techniques involve using your fretting hand to create notes without picking the strings, adding fluidity and speed to your playing.
